About article:
During the period 1940 – 1943 Jozef Kresánek worked as an official of the Musical Section of
Matica slovenská in Martin. Here he had the opportunity to make acquaintance, among other
sources, with the extensive manuscript collection of Slovak folk songs by Karol Plicka. Kresánek,
when processing this collection for the first time, gained knowledge which he afterwards put
to use in his synthetic work Slovenská ľudová pieseň zo stanoviska hudobného [The Slovak Folk
Song from the Musical Standpoint] (1951, 21997). Here he used Plicka’s manuscript records
of Slovak folk songs to illustrate individual styles in Slovak folk singing. Apart from adopting
selected extracts, Kresánek relies in this work on the various studies by Plicka, establishing
continuity and simultaneously reevaluating them in the light of his own knowledge.
